'NYT' Hails Stephen King -- As He Boosts MoveOn.org

NEW YORK Sometimes -- okay, nearly always -- timing is everything. So it seemed for the liberal political action group MoveOn.org today. Just hours after his latest book got a rare rave in The New York Times, horror novelist Stephen King emailed a big election year pitch for MoveOn.

You'd almost think it was a liberal conspiracy.

"If I know anything, I know scary," King emailed. "And giving this president and this out-of-control Congress two more years to screw up our future is downright terrifying. Thankfully, this national nightmare is one we can end with—literally—a wake up call.

"My friends at MoveOn.org Political Action are organizing pre-Halloween phone parties this weekend, Oct. 28th & 29th....And since it's almost Halloween, we'll celebrate with an optional costume contest, some pumpkin carving (I'll be making a Jack-Abramoff-O'-Lantern) and—of course—plenty of candy."

Janet Maslin in the Times called King's new Scribner's book, "Lisey's Story," a "tender, intimate book that makes an epic interior journey without covering much physical terrain." She considers it "haunting even by Mr. King's standards."
